> >>>> On Tue, Apr 07, 2026 at 05:02:05PM +0200, Jan Martin Mikkelsen wrote:
> >>>>> Hi,
> >>>>> 
> >>>>> I am consistently getting the panic below while building lang/perl5.42. This is the command from the perl build that triggers the panic:
> >>>>> 
> >>>>> /usr/bin/strip /ports-work/usr/ports/lang/perl5.42/work/stage/usr/local/bin/perl5.42.0
> >>>>> 
> >>>>> CURRENT on aarch64, with a kernel from last week, also with a later one from the  weekend. A kernel from mid-January worked fine.
> >>>>> 
> >>>>> I can reproduce on demand, no parallelism in the build required.
> >>>>> 
> >>>>> Does this look familiar to anyone?
> >>>>> 
> >>>>> panic: cache_vop_rename: lingering negative entry
> >>>>> cpuid = 4
> >>>>> time = 1775410763
> >>>>> KDB: stack backtrace:
> >>>>> db_trace_self() at db_trace_self
> >>>>> db_trace_self_wrapper() at db_trace_self_wrapper+0x38
> >>>>> vpanic() at vpanic+0x1a0
> >>>>> panic() at panic+0x48
> >>>>> cache_vop_rename() at cache_vop_rename+0xb0
> >>>>> zfs_do_rename() at zfs_do_rename+0xafc
> >>>>> zfs_freebsd_rename() at zfs_freebsd_rename+0x5c
> >>>>> VOP_RENAME_APV() at VOP_RENAME_APV+0x44
> >>>>> kern_renameat () at kern_renameat+0x574
> >>>>> do_el0_sync() at do_el0_sync+0x5f8
> >>>>> handle_el0_sync() at handle_el0_sync+0x4c
> >>>>> --- exception, esr 0x56000000
> >>>>> KDB: enter: panic
> >>>>> [ thread pid 81230 tid 101738 ]
> >>>>> Stopped at kdb_enter+0x48: str xzr, [x19, #3072]
> >>>> 
> >>>> Is it reproducable on UFS and/or tmpfs?
> >>> 
> >>> Successful completion (no panic) when the work directory is on UFS, and when the work directory is on tmpfs. I didn’t try multiple times, but it never works on ZFS.
> >> 
> >> The panic consistently reproduces on a ZFS filesystem with the properties  “utf8only=on” and "normalization=formD”.
> >> 
> >> A ZFS file system with “utf8only=off” and "normalization=none” works fine.
> >> 
> >> As far as I can see, strip makes a simple rename(2) call, and testing rename(2) works fine (as expected). Running the same strip command on the same files on a fresh system works fine.
> >> 
> >> The smallest reproducer I have at the moment is building lang/perl5.42.0 with a workdir on a ZFS filesystem enforcing UTF8.

> > I am now sure that the reason is that the options you used cause the same
> > inode to have more than one name (but not hardlinks).  I remember that
> > zfs had option to be case-insensitive, but I may mis-remember.
> > 
> > The solution, in any case, is to either stop using namecache when these
> > options are activated, or at least purge all cached entries that has the
> > given dst when the dst vnode is renamed or deleted.
> > 
> > Somebody who knows zfs would be needed to make the change.
> 
> I had a look at the ZFS source, and found this:
> 
>         /*
>          * Only use the name cache if we are looking for a
>          * name on a file system that does not require normalization
>          * or case folding.  We can also look there if we happen to be
>          * on a non-normalizing, mixed sensitivity file system IF we
>          * are looking for the exact name (which is always the case on
>          * FreeBSD).
>          */
>         zfsvfs->z_use_namecache = !zfsvfs->z_norm ||
>             ((zfsvfs->z_case == ZFS_CASE_MIXED) &&
>             !(zfsvfs->z_norm & ~U8_TEXTPREP_TOUPPER));
> 
> 
> The call to cache_vop_rename() which causes the panic is not protected by an “if (zfsvfs->z_use_namecache)”, unlike the rest of the code that uses that to decide whether or not to use the namecache.
> 
> Elsewhere in zfs_vnops_os.c, there is another call to a cache_vop* function, which is protected by a test:
> 
>         if (zfsvfs->z_use_namecache)
>                 cache_vop_rmdir(dvp, vp);
> 
> It seems to me that this patch could resolve the problem. Does this seem reasonable?
> 
> --- a/src/sys/contrib/openzfs/module/os/freebsd/zfs/zfs_vnops_os.c	2026-03-28 20:55:06.000000000 1100
> +++ b/src/sys/contrib/openzfs/module/os/freebsd/zfs/zfs_vnops_os.c	2026-03-28 20:55:06.000000000 1100
> @@ -3524,7 +3524,7 @@
>  				    ZRENAMING, NULL));
>  			}
>  		}
> -		if (error == 0) {
> +		if (error == 0 && zfsvfs->z_use_namecache) {
>  			cache_vop_rename(sdvp, *svpp, tdvp, *tvpp, scnp, tcnp);
>  		}
>  	}
> 

Yes, but please test.
